ResponsibilitiesReporting to a Construction Manager, the responsibilities will include but not be limited to:
Project Planning and Execution
- Understand our client's needs and the scope of the project.
- Estimate resources needed to complete projects.
- Oversee CPM, 3 Week, and 9 Day schedules.
- Pre-costing activities of work.
- Manage the cost report, AR and AP aspect of assigned projects.
Team Management
- Manage one or more direct reports.
Safety Management
- Conduct site safety surveys to evaluate safety program implementation.
- Monitor subcontractor safety performance to ensure Cal-OSHA compliance.
- Implement and enforce company and client safety policies.
